Cardio load is appearing on my charge 6, but I am unable to set it up. I get the first 2 screens in setup without difficulty but get an error on the third and have to exit. On the today screen of the App it shows cardio load but always says it’s calibrating. I do get a score most days, just don’t get a target range. Any idea when this will be fixed?

Hi David,
UK user here, I've been advised to post into this thread as I'm still having issues with cardio load figures, namely the fact that I can do high intensity workouts (e.g.Zwift) with my Pixel Watch 3 recording the heart rate zones into the Fitbit app, but with a zero or near zero cardio load. Oddly, Google Health seems to pick up the load time.
I've tried using 'spinning ' and ' cycling ' , the latter with a manual input of virtual distance ( which doesn't always save) , but no difference. This is resulting in the app thinking I've not done any activity on the day, and also doing calculations for following day. It tells me I've been relatively inactive, which I've definitely not. The app has been uninstalled and reinstalled, all cache and storage cleared, and I'm running version 4.34.1. Am I missing something simple here or is there an issue?
